Georges Simenon is the master of the detective genre, the author of more than 200 novels and short stories translated into 57 languages in 39 countries. The total circulation of his books in the world is 500,000,000 copies. He made a real revolution in the history of the detective. His hero, the commissar of the crime police of Megre, is just as popular in the world as Sherlock Holmes, but at the same time – his exact opposite. Not logic, not a deductive method, not cold and impartial knowledge – “weapons” Megre is different: sympathy for people, even criminals, observation, desire to communicate and help. His investigation method is humanity, the ability to arouse trust. At the same time, Megre is an outstanding detective, a real professional! In the art world of Simenon, criminals are always awaiting a fair punishment, because the investigation is conducted by Commissioner Megre – a talented and noble person.
